StudioRAID Features
Brushed, stainless steel face plate 1/8” thick (3MM)
Scratch-resistant black powder-coated aluminum chassis
Engineered to support professional audio and video
Supports two software-selectable drive modes: RAID 1 and RAID 0.
Internal power supply, no wall wart, internal quiet fan
3 Year Warranty
2 Year Free Basic Data Recovery
Advance Replacement in 1st year of warranty within U.S. Continental 48 States only.

Content Creation Applications
Qualied with Final Cut Pro, Avid Xpress, Adobe Premiere.
Qualied with all major audio production packages that support FireWire storage, including Digidesign Pro
Tools, Steinberg Nuendo and Cubase, Apple Logic, MOTU Digital Performer, Cakewalk Sonar, Sony Vegas and
more...
Conguration
The StudioRAID can be rack mounted in a standard 19-inch rack with Glyph’s optional rack kits. There is a
single kit (part# GPT-RACKMOUNT KIT v2) for mounting one drive, and a dual kit (part# GPT-RACKMOUNT
KIT v2) for mounting two drives. The dual kit allows any two of Glyph’s StudioRAID Series tabletop drives to
be mounted in a double rack space.
